MAXSUN's Arc Pro B60 Dual is DOA thanks to Intel's failure

MAXSUN prepares to release its Arc Pro B60 Dual 48G Turbo graphics card on August 18th, according to Reddit sources. A user reported discussions with company management regarding shipment schedules to Singapore next week. The card features two BMG-G21 GPU dies with independent 24GB memory pools totaling 48GB capacity. Professional and artificial intelligence workloads benefit from this dual-die configuration rather than gaming applications. Each processor handles separate datasets independently for enhanced parallel computing performance.

Intel faces production constraints limiting B60 availability across both standard and dual variants. The manufacturer restricts sales through system integrators rather than consumer retail channels due to inventory shortages. Early production runs were completely reserved before public launch. The dual variant carries an estimated $1200 price tag compared to the single B60's $500 retail cost. MAXSUN also develops an AI workstation featuring dual B60 cards with Core Ultra processors and 256GB system memory for a September release at approximately $2800.
